RoachAir Force Office of Scientific ResearchArlington, Virginia 22203Abstract. One application of ultrashort pulse filamentation is the couplingof external electric fields to filament plasmas and guiding of high-voltagedischarges. However, the full physics of the guiding mechanism is still inquestion. Several models have been presented and explanations havebeen suggested to capture the full physics of the discharge event. Forthe first time, measurements of the electric field dynamics between twoelectrodes during filament-guided discharges are presented here, to thebest of our knowledge. The electric field dynamics show an exponentialgrowth region, a plateau, followed by a sharp drop off coinciding withthe discharge event. We believe these results will ultimately answer thequestions regarding the guiding mechanism.
